How many watts does a solar panel carry
Most residential panels in 2025 are rated 250–550 watts, with 400-watt models becoming the new standard. A 400-watt panel can generate roughly 1. 5 kWh of energy per day, depending on local sunlight. How many watts of solar energy can a 48v 200a battery use
To charge a 200Ah battery (2,400Wh), use a solar panel with at least 600 watts.
